Jordan Brungard received the Award for Excellence in the Arts (AEA) from the Washington D.C. chapter of the National Society for Arts & Letters for Damascus High School. Each year, high school faculty nominate junior-year students who excel in any of six artistic disciplines. They collaborate to select one Award for Excellence honoree from each school. Each year, the AEA program recognizes juniors from some 30 high schools in the DC metro area. This year the awards ceremony will take place at National Presbysterian Church on May 23.
Jordan is very involved in the music program at Damascus High School. She plays French horn in the band and piano in the jazz band & pit orchestra for 2 musicals each year and is taking AP Music Theory. Jordan is the Tri-M Music Honor Society president and has performed in their annual recitals. This year on May 10, she has the distinct honor to perform Gershwin's Rhapsody in Blue with the band accompanying her!
